Hi Ron. Your speaking to me! Here is what I think.
1. Listen to your gut even if it doesn’t make sense immediately.
2. Be kind vs nice. People walk all over nice people.
3. Always make sure your on the list. You don’t have to be number 1 all the time but be on the list
4. Know what is self care for you. It’s different for everyone.
5. Always stay true to your values. Not societal values or things you think you should value.
These are my thoughts. I have been a people pleaser for years and it didn’t serve me well. Remember when you change everything changes. We can only control s.
